1. An image processing method for a game loop of a game, wherein the game loop comprises a game rendering module and a motion estimation and motion compensation (MEMC) module, and a program of the game loop is stored in a non-transitory computer-readable medium and executed by more than one processing unit to generate an output image to display, the image processing method comprising:
rendering, by the game rendering module, a scene of the game to obtain a first image;
rendering, by the game rendering module, a user interface (UI) to obtain a second image;
applying, by the MEMC module, MEMC to the first image to generate an interpolated first image; and
blending, by the MEMC module, the second image and the interpolated first image into the output image to display.
